Step 2: Understand Your HVAC System
Not all smart thermostats work with every system. Single-stage, multi-stage, heat pump, or forced air — you need to know which one you have. Take a photo of your old thermostat’s wiring before removing it. Label each wire with sticky notes. Most modern units come with a compatibility checker on the manufacturer’s website. If you see wires labeled W2, Y2, or C, you likely have a heat pump or multi-stage system. Step 3: The Installation Process Done Right
Turn off power to your HVAC system at the breaker before touching any wires. Remove the old thermostat faceplate and backplate. Mount the new base using drywall anchors if needed. Connect wires to the corresponding terminals on the new base — typically R (power), W (heat), Y (cool), G (fan), and C (common). Use the provided level to ensure it’s straight. After securing, restore power and follow the on-screen setup wizard. This is where many first-timers get stuck because they skip the step of checking the system’s operation mode (cooling vs. heating) after wiring. A quick test using the digital multimeter can confirm that each terminal gets the correct voltage.

Step 4: Optimize Your Schedules and Alerts
After installation, spend a few days manually adjusting the temperature so the thermostat learns your preferences. Most smart models offer geofencing — it can tell when you leave and enter your home and adjust accordingly. Enable alerts for extreme temperature changes or filter replacement reminders. If your thermostat comes with room sensors, place one in the bedroom and one in the living area to balance hot and cold spots.
